Block

#18,019,320
Block Number
18,019,320 @ 03/18/2024, 24:13:10
Status
Finalized
ID
0x0112f3f8ebeaf95642bfc9bb89d0426f02da91575b77a8b44b8dd5600d4c963b
Transactions
Gas Used
57646/30000000 (0.19% Used)
Total Score
1,756,555,063 (+96)
Rewards
0.17 VTHO